The value of Peter's house has risen 30% a year for the last 3 years. If the value of Peter's home 3 years ago was $120,000.00,
navik [9.2K]

Step-by-step explanation:

The price has gone up by 30% each year so each year it is 130% compared to last year. that means a price rate of 1.3^n, with n as number of years gone by. In this case n=3 so 1.3^3=2.197. $120,000.00×2.197=$263,640.00, which is D

A company makes a profit of $y (in thousand dollars) when it produces x computers,
leva [86]

Using quadratic function concepts, it is found that:

a) The value of a is -2000.

b) The maximum profit the company can make is of $5,000,000, when 150 computers should be produced.

c) Between 140 and 160 computers need to be produced.

The profit is modeled by:

y = a(x - 100)(x - 200)

Item a:

If 120  computers are produced, the profit will be $3,200,000, hence when x = 120, y = 3200000, and this is used to find a.

y = a(x - 100)(x - 200)

3200000 = a(120 - 100)(120 - 200)

-1600a = 3200000

a = -\frac{3200000}{1600}

a = -2000

The value of a is -2000.

Item b:

We first place the quadratic function into standard form, thus:

y = -2000(x - 100)(x - 200)

y = -2000(x^2 - 300x + 20000)

y = -2000x^2 + 600000x - 40000000

Which has coefficients a = -2000, b = 600000, c = -40000000.

Then, we have to find the vertex:

x_V = -\frac{b}{2a} = -\frac{600000}{2(-2000)} = 150

\Delta = b^2 - 4ac = (600000)^2 - 4(-2000)(-40000000) = 40000000000


y_V = -\frac{\Delta}{4a} = -\frac{40000000000
}{4(-2000)} = 5000000

The maximum profit the company can make is of $5,000,000, when 150 computers should be produced.

Item c:

We are working with a concave down parabola, hence the range is <u>between the roots of</u>:

y = -200x^2 + 600000x - 40000000

4800000 = -200x^2 + 600000x - 40000000

-200x^2 + 600000x - 44800000 = 0

The coefficients are a = -200, b = 600000, c = -44800000.

Then:

\Delta = b^2 - 4ac = (600000)^2 - 4(-2000)(-44800000) = 1600000000

x_1 = \frac{-b - \sqrt{Delta}}{2a} = \frac{-600000 - \sqrt{1600000000}}{2(-2000)} = 160

x_2 = \frac{-b + \sqrt{Delta}}{2a} = \frac{-600000 + \sqrt{1600000000}}{2(-2000)} = 140

Between 140 and 160 computers need to be produced.

A=c+(-10) Solve for c in terms of other variables.
True [87]
To do this we need to move 10 to other side.  To accomplish this you just need to add 10 to both side since (-10) 

so 
A+ 10 = c -10 + 10 
we get
A+ 10 = c

lets say it wasn't -10 but positive 10. 

A = c + 10  then we would subtract 10 from both sides

A -10 = c + 10 - 10 
we get 
A  - 10 = C
